Material Aluminum Nitride (AlN) is a ceramic compound possessing remarkable properties. Its high thermal conductivity, typically ranging from 200 to 320 W/m·K, makes it ideal for heat sinking applications in electronics. Furthermore, it exhibits excellent electrical insulation capabilities, good mechanical strength, and high chemical stability at elevated temperatures. These attributes allow its employment in a broad spectrum of fields, including LED substrate manufacturing, power device packaging, high-frequency circuits, and protective coatings for turbines. Ongoing research explores its use in novel applications such as advanced ceramics and sensors.

Aluminum Nitride Thermal Conductivity: A Deep Dive

Aluminum compound exhibits remarkably exceptional thermal transmissivity, a characteristic making it suited for various thermal control applications. Its inherent structure, a wurtzite lattice, facilitates efficient phonon movement, leading to measurements often exceeding those of traditional ceramics like alumina. Elements influencing this functionality include grain size, density, and the presence of minor impurities; therefore, careful processing and refinement techniques are crucial to optimize the resulting thermal characteristics. Further study focuses on manipulating microstructure to further improve its overall efficiency as a heat spreader.
